China angered as Hong Kong activists granted asylum in UK, Australia | Hong Kong Protests

NewsFeed

Hong Kong activist Tony Chung and ex-lawmaker Ted Hui have been granted asylum in the UK and Australia, years after facing charges linked to the 2019 anti-government protests. Both fled amid Beijing’s crackdown under the national security law that criminalised dissent.
